Transaction 50dddc7a325a306b2dd12fb4ccb29ebefbf3c6fe9ad51d71cdd69fecbb2f3758
1 Input
2 Outputs
- 50dddc7a325a306b2dd12fb4ccb29ebefbf3c6fe9ad51d71cdd69fecbb2f3758:0
- 50dddc7a325a306b2dd12fb4ccb29ebefbf3c6fe9ad51d71cdd69fecbb2f3758:1
value 1366149
address 343twKWvWtxzfoCahz7rPpU6gUCT4Hrg3t
value 67053816
address 1EWr8SrYXWbGtb2S3XwCz3JGeQkBv4wRpx